WHAT YOU NEED TO KNOW ABOUT THE JOB :

As the Senior Principal, IT Governance, Risk and Compliance (GRC), you will be primarily responsible for supporting the delivery of a successful governance, risk, and compliance (GRC) program at the American Red Cross.

You will design, implement, and monitor a comprehensive IT policy and control framework, supporting mission-critical business systems and processes leveraging the Red Cross ServiceNow platform for Integrated Risk Management. This framework will meet minimum requirements including NIST 800-53, NIST 800-171, and best practices in IT governance, security, risk, and compliance. Working closely with key stakeholders and cross-functional colleagues, you will advise on the design and execute assessments to identify areas of improvement. You will also work with IT and business leadership to remediate any gaps as a first line of defense.

The primary focus of this position will be serving as the key liaison and coordination point between IT / Business teams and Internal Audit to ensure alignment, transparency, and effective execution of audit-related activities. This role will drive collaboration across teams to support audit readiness, remediation efforts, and continuous improvement of IT controls. In addition, the position will contribute to maturing the American Red Cross GRC program through process optimization, policy development, automation, training, and ongoing enhancement of governance capabilities. This is a unique opportunity to combine IT, audit, and process improvement expertise while working closely with leaders across IT, Information Security, Internal Audit, Finance, and the Office of General Counsel (OGC).

WHERE YOUR CAREER IS A FORCE FOR GOOD (Key Responsibilities) :

Audit Coordination & Support :

  • Work with Internal and External auditors, business stakeholders and suppliers as appropriate on required IT control assessments and audits
  • Provide first level of support and consulting to the business and IT on internal audit activities and results as well as risk mitigation initiatives in response to audit findings
  • Manage overall remediation process and create and oversee action plans to remediate issues

Overall Governance, Risk, and Compliance :

  • Assist the Director, IT Governance, Risk, and Compliance and Senior Director, IT Governance, Risk and Compliance with IT governance and controls, internal and external audit readiness and support, and policy and standard development
  • Responsible for daily governance, risk, control, and compliance functions leveraging ServiceNow
  • Participate in and contribute to the IT Governance, Risk and Compliance program, ensuring IT controls, policies, processes, and procedures support the mission of the Red Cross and meet state and federal regulations and laws, as well as best practices
  • Collaborate with and influence technology and business leaders and staff to create, sustain, and strengthen internal control framework for the organization through control identification, design, implementation, and testing
  • Provide guidance, training, and motivation necessary to create control awareness, ownership and accountability to stakeholders
  • Consult with Information Security, Office of General Counsel / Legal, Supply Management, Risk Management, Audit Services, and other appropriate parties sharing expertise and knowledge to strengthen the Red Cross control environment
  • Interpret regulatory compliance requirements and assist with gap analysis of current policies, procedures, and practices as they relate to established guidelines outlined by NIST-800-53 / 171 / 30 and other regulatory standards
  • Provide guidance, interpretation, and support of SOC 1 and SOC 2 Security Trust criteria
  • Research regulations by reviewing regulatory bulletins and other sources of information, to maintain quality service by establishing and enforcing organization standards
  • Support the maintenance of program processes and procedures using ServiceNow
  • Control Assessment Process :

  • As a subject matter expert (SME), participate in on-going evaluations and validation of IT control effectiveness and internal business processes via ServiceNow and other tools, as they relate to compliance activities within areas of responsibility
  • Review control documentation to assess the quality and effectiveness of the implemented controls
  • Identify and communicate opportunities to enhance technical controls which contribute to sustaining a robust control environment
  • Document, track, and report on control gap findings, risk, impacts and recommendations to management
  • Participate in the establishment of actionable metrics to drive the control assessment process and influence behaviors to IT Leadership
  • Manage the Exception and Risk Acceptance Process as it relates to control gaps and audit findings
  • Policy, Standard, and Procedures :

  • Support and assist with coordination and implementation of Information Technology policies and standards to sustain regulatory and compliance initiatives as required by the business needs
  • Work and consult with the President's Office during policy review and communication
  • Analyze policies, standards, procedures, and guidelines for regulatory and compliance requirements, and recommend solutions for identified weaknesses, to improve compliance operations, recommend and assist in changes to best practices

    WHAT YOU NEED TO SUCCEED (required / minimum qualifications) :

  • Bachelor's degree in a related field required (IT, audit, and / or information security) or closely related discipline.
  • Minimum 10 years of related experience or equivalent combination of education and related experience required
  • 3-5 years of experience in Governance, Risk, and Compliance roles with hands-on ServiceNow GRC experience
  • Service Now Integrated Risk Management experience is required.
  • Working knowledge of control frameworks, IT general controls, and security controls such as, NIST, ISO, COBIT, FedRAMP, SOC 2, ISO 27001
  • Highly motivated and proactive with strong organizational, communication, and project management skills
  • Experience drafting, remediating, or editing of IT policies, standards, procedures and controls
  • Experience working cross-functional with engineers, product and security teams, business leaders at all levels of the organization
  • Experience coordinating with internal and / or external audit teams
  • Ability to understand key controls and communicate them in a digestible way to IT technologists, control owners, and senior leaders
  • Strong written and oral communication skills with utilization of appropriate tools (MS Excel, ServiceNow, etc.)
  • Solid analytical and problem-solving skills in process review and issue remediation
  • Open-mindedness, creative thinking, willingness to take calculated risks, and make informed decisions
